Pinus montezumae (Montezuma Pine)

Type Tree, Conifer, Evergreen
Form Compact Rounded Tree, Architectural Form
Size Large Tree (8m or more height)
Colours Medium green Foliage
Care Low/Easy Maintenance - Tough Plant
Hardiness Frost hardy, Drought Tolerant, Seaside Friendly
Growth Slow Growing Plant

Pinus montezumae - Cultivation Notes

The hardy pine prefers a poorer well drained, sandy soil on neutral to acid (not chalky) soil. Plant in an open sunny shade free position including any cold and exposured spots. Don’t prune unless for shape or to removing dead weak wood


Strengths, Weaknesses & Design Usage

Strengths of Pinus montezumae:
  • Sun loving drought tolerant plant
  • Ornamental winter bark / tracery
  • All round tough plant suitable for problem areas
  • Evergreen foliage for all year round colour and screening
  • Architectural plant – ideal as a ‘stand out’ plant
  • Suitable for exposed coastal planting
  • Attractive form or foliage for all year interest
  • Tolerates full sun and sandy, drought-prone soils
Weaknesses of Pinus montezumae
  • Does not produce showy attractive flowers
Design & Plant Use for Pinus montezumae:
  • Added winter interest from attractive bark or stems
